Statistics & Facts
The population of Cape Girardeau is approximately 37,156 (2007).
The approximate number of families is 15,827 (2000).
The amount of land area in Cape Girardeau is 59.582 sq. kilometers.
The amount of land area in Cape Girardeau is 24.3 sq. miles.
The amount of surface water is 0.093 sq kilometers.
The distance from Cape Girardeau to Washington DC is 719 miles. The distance to the Missouri state capital is 173 miles. (as the crow flies)
Cape Girardeau is positioned 37.30 degrees north of the equator and 89.55 degrees west of the prime meridian.
Cape Girardeau elevation is 351 feet above sea level.
Cape Girardeau per capita income is $18,918 (2000).
Cape Girardeau median income is $41,052 (2007).
The Cape Girardeau median home price is $124,204 (2007).

Location
Cape Girardeau location: on I-55 on the west bank of the Mississippi River, 110 miles south of St Louis, Missouri and 160 miles north of Memphis, Tennessee. Other nearby communities include East Cape Girardeau, Scott City, Kelso, Dutchtown, Gordonville, Jackson and Chaffee all in Missouri and Thebes in Illinois.

Climate & Weather
The weather in Cape Girardeau is seasonal. There is an annual average snowfall of 11 inches.
Cape Girardeau average annual rainfall is 45.4 inches per year
Cape Girardeau average annual snowfall is 11 inches per year.
Cape Girardeau average temperature is 57.48 degrees. degrees F.
The average winter temperature is 33.17 degrees F.
The average summer temperature is 80 degrees F.

History & History Related Items
Cape Girardeau history: A French officer and fur trader, Sieur Jean B. Girardot came to Cape Rock around 1733. The name "Cape Girardeau" came from the combing of his name and Cape Rock. The cape was later demolished during railroad construction years later. About 1792, Louis Lorimier came as Spain's agent in Indian affairs. He began building the city after receiving large land grants. After being plotted in 1806, the town was incorporated in 1808. The area was part of the 1803 Louisiana Purchase. The old 20 foot bridge across the Mississippi was built in September 1928 and replaced a ferry. In December 2003, a new four lane cable stay bridge was completed and named the Bill Emerson Memorial Bidge for former US Representative Bill Emerson who helped to get the funding to build the bridge. Cape Girardeau was also known to some as "The City of Roses" because of a nine-mile stretch of highway that was once lined with dozens of rose bushes. Although there used to be many prominent rose gardens around the community, few of these gardens are in existence today. Try this history page for the city. The settling of Cape Girardeau: 1733 by trader and French soldier, Jean B. Girardot
The founding of Cape Girardeau: 1793, January 4 by Louis Lorimier
The incorporation date of Cape Girardeau: 1808 (as a town before Missouri statehood); Re-incorporated 1843 as a city.
